| principal point |
The point on the earth where a satellite sensor is focused at any time during its orbit. If the sensor vertical axis is perpendicular to the earth's surface, the principal point coincides with the subpoint. 2. A term used in remote sensing; the point where the optical axis intersects the principal plane.

| principal point |
The point at which lines drawn between opposing fiducials on an aerial photograph intersect. The center point of an aerial photograph.
